About RSI RSI is a dynamic group of companies that has provided services to major federal clients and Fortune 500 engineering and construction companies since 1996. We have experience in complex, highly regulated markets providing environmental, nuclear, construction management, project delivery, and specialty professional services while maintaining an excellent safety record. We offer a full range of benefits including a generous PTO plan, paid holidays, medical, dental, vision, 401K (100% match up to 4% eligible compensation) and 100% immediate vesting, basic and supplemental life insurance, and short- and long-term disability. RSI is headquartered in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, and is a wholly owned operating company of ASRC Industrial (AIS). AIS is a wholly owned operating company of Arctic Slope Regional Corporation (ASRC), an Alaska Native Corporation (ANC). Through ASRC, we are a certified Minority Business Enterprise (MBE) and Small Disadvantaged Business (SDB), and we also offer 8(a) options. Position Summary RSI is currently recruiting for a Senior Advisor to support ongoing radiological environmental projects. The Senior Advisor will be focused on providing high-level technical consulting and guidance to project teams and leadership, particularly in support of technical execution and regulatory interface. This is a remote, part-time casual position working on an on-call basis, with the potential for occasional travel to project sites as needed. The target start date is as soon as possible, and the pay range for this role is $100–$125 per hour, depending on experience and qualifications. Primary Responsibilities The ideal candidate is a seasoned technical expert with extensive experience in radiological environmental remediation and regulatory engagement. Responsibilities include: Provide senior-level consulting support on radiological environmental projects Support the Technical Manager in execution, documentation, presentation, and defense of technical project aspects Prepare and review technical documents for government clients and state/federal regulators Develop and review responses to client and regulate comments, questions, and requests for information Consult with project management and clients regarding technical execution and regulatory strategy Participate in technical discussions and presentations as needed Required Education and Experience Bachelor’s degree in a technical field (e.g., environmental science, health physics, engineering, or related discipline) Twenty (20) + years of experience in radiological environmental remediation Extensive experience working with state and federal government clients and regulatory agencies Strong technical writing and communication skills Job Knowledge/Qualifications Proven experience supporting radiological environmental projects in highly regulated environments Deep understanding of regulatory frameworks and compliance requirements Ability to review, interpret, and develop complex technical documentation Strong communication and advisory skills with the ability to influence technical direction Ability to work independently in a remote, on-call capacity High level of professionalism and responsiveness Work may be required outside normal business hours and sometimes on short notice Must be willing and able to travel, as needed Clearance and Health Regiments Criminal Background Check Pre-placement Drug Screening EEO Statement ASRC Industrial (AIS) and its operating companies affords equal opportunity in employment to all individuals regardless of race, color, religion, sex, age, national origin, pregnancy, familial status, disability status, veteran status, citizenship status, genetic information or any other characteristic protected under Federal, State or Local law.
